 Florida Tech Research - Spring 2025 IssueFlorida Tech Research is an annual publication dedicated to showcasing the community of innovators at Florida Institute of Technology and its impactful research and scholarship. Reflecting the university’s relentless pursuit of understanding and drive to improve the world around us, Florida Tech Research showcases discovery across the variety of disciplines represented on campus. The magazine is distributed to an audience of local and national media, decision-makers, and students, faculty, staff and friends of the university.
